Alright ladies—there’s a new kid on a new block. This fall, the east side of town welcomed Amanda’s Hyde Park Bridal in, you guessed it, Hyde Park. This adorable new boutique offers an exclusive selection of gorgeous, on-trend bridal gowns and accessories. We recently visited the shop to get a taste of what’s in-store for our local brides.

Roll out the cupcakes and bubbly. For real. There are literally tiny pink cupcakes and glasses of champagne for you and your shopping party.  And why not? This is far and away the most expensive dress that (most of us) will ever buy. A little royal treatment is not out of order. Hyde Park Bridal offers a “by appointment only” personalized experience. This means that the shop is closed to the public and their undivided attention is focused on you, the bride. We fell completely in love with the plush interior and crazy-pink shop design. It’s way over the top. In a good way. 

Hyde Park Bridal carries exclusive designers like Hayley Paige, Blush, Alvina Valenta, and Badgley Mischka, among others. Owner Amanda Topits has curated a stunning collection of gowns with a great attention to contemporary details and a respect for classic appeal. The result is an exceptional style for every girl—from a full on princess gown to a oh-so-current peplum look to a whimsical tulle number. And there’s a price point for just about everyone, as the gowns range from $1,500 – $9,000.

Owner Amanda is a super sweet hometown girl. The DAAP fashion grad has worked in the bridal industry for years, honing her skills before opening her own boutique. She even has plans to design her own bridal line in the near future. Her taste in bridal designers is impeccable, so we can’t wait to see what she brings to our local market.
